Idiosyncratic Drug-Induced Liver Injury Associated With and Without Drug Reaction With Eosinophilia and Systemic Symptoms.

Harshad DevarbhaviSunu Sara KurienSujata RajMallikarjun PatilVinod GowdaKsheetij KothariRajvir Singh
Published in: The American journal of gastroenterology (2022)
A limited number of drugs cause DwD, representing a fifth of patients with DILI. DwD is characterized by lesser degrees of liver injury and mortality likely because of earlier presentation.
